Transparency and Trust: How to Choose the Right Charter Broker
Evaluating for Integrity: The Charter Broker Due Diligence Checklist
Trust distinguishes the value of any charter brokerage, especially in a field where appearance and substance often diverge. Clients who rely on private jet charter services for critical business travel or personal milestones must know precisely how their broker operates behind polished websites and quick quotes.
Effective vetting starts with asking direct questions - not just about aircraft, but about the broker's business ethics, operational diligence, and commitment to transparency. The right partner welcomes these inquiries as standard practice.
Operator background and safety records: Ask how aircraft operators are selected and vetted. Are maintenance logs, certificates, and insurance documents available for your review? A reputable broker provides proof without hesitation or delay.
Comprehensive pricing breakdowns: Request a full explanation of every fee, including fuel surcharges, repositioning, and cancellation terms. Reliable charter brokerage Texas clients rely on ensures quotes reflect true total cost - no post-flight surprises.
Clear contracts and regulatory compliance: Examine sample agreements for clarity. Contracts should specify responsibilities, compliance with FAA Part 135 rules, liability coverage details, and clear recourse if services don't match promises.
Proven client reviews and operational references: A trustworthy broker readily supplies references from frequent travelers or corporate flight departments confirming prior transaction integrity and reliability under changing conditions.
Spotting Warning Signs
Vague or rushed answers when questioned about safety protocols or operator credentials.
Contracts littered with ambiguous language, shifting terms mid-process, or minimal documentation shared before a deposit is required.
Brokers averse to clarifying fee structures line-by-line - or who deflect requests for end-user access to operators and pilots.
